RGB Gaming Desktop Mouse Keyboard Headset Sync Setup in SA: Start With One Control Plan
The easiest way to keep your setup sane is to decide who is in charge of the lighting. If your keyboard, mouse, and headset all use different software, you’ll spend more time clicking than gaming. A cleaner approach is to buy peripherals that can be controlled through one ecosystem, or at least ones that can match colour modes manually.
For South African buyers, that matters. Power cuts, desk resets, and fast upgrades are part of the reality here. You want a setup that looks good without needing a full rebuild every time you swap one device.

RGB Gaming Desktop Mouse Keyboard Headset Sync Setup in SA: Make the Lighting Look Intentional
Here’s the trick most people miss... matching every device to the exact same colour is not always the best look. A setup feels more premium when the colours complement each other. Think one strong accent colour, then softer lighting on the rest.
For example, a keyboard in static white, a mouse in a gentle blue pulse, and a headset in a dim cyan glow can look far cleaner than a rainbow explosion. If you stream, this also helps the camera pick up your gear without visual clutter.
Simple sync rules
- Use one main colour family
- Keep brightness lower than you think
- Avoid too many breathing effects at once
- Test the setup in a dark room before settling on it
RGB Sync Pro Tip ⚡
Before installing every lighting app, check whether your mouse and keyboard can run well from a single suite. Fewer apps usually mean fewer startup issues, less RAM use, and a cleaner experience after a reboot.
RGB Gaming Desktop Mouse Keyboard Headset Sync Setup in SA: Why Clean Cable Management Still Matters
Even if your peripherals are wireless, some cables will remain. Headset charging cables, USB dongles, and maybe a mouse cable all need a home. Clean cable routing makes RGB pop more because the eye focuses on the gear, not the clutter.
That’s especially useful in smaller South African rooms or shared gaming spaces, where a tidy desk can make a big visual difference. A neat setup also makes it easier to clean, which sounds minor until dust starts building up around your keyboard and mouse pads.
RGB Gaming Desktop Mouse Keyboard Headset Sync Setup in SA: Buy for the Long Term, Not Just the Look
RGB is fun, but you’ll enjoy your setup more if the devices are solid first and flashy second. Check click feel, battery life, software support, and warranty coverage before you commit. In South Africa, value matters. A slightly more expensive peripheral can be the better buy if it lasts longer and works smoothly across future upgrades.
If you’re building your desk from scratch, think in layers:
- Get the mouse right
- Match the keyboard lighting
- Add a headset that complements the setup
- Fine-tune brightness and effects last
That approach keeps spending under control and avoids regret purchases.
